In Gui Zhi Fu Ling Wan, which ingredient is described as 'honey'?

Explanation:
Bai Mi literally means honey. In Gui Zhi Fu Ling Wan, the ingredient described as “honey” refers to this honey component, which is used as an excipient or processing aid to prepare the pills and harmonize the formula. The other items are herbs themselves, not described as honey. So the option labeled as honey is the ingredient denoted by Bai Mi.
